WitrynaOnce heroin enters the brain, it is converted to morphine and binds rapidly to opioid receptors.11 People who use heroin typically report feeling a surge of pleasurable sensation—a "rush." The intensity of the rush is a function of how much drug is taken and how rapidly the drug enters the brain and binds to the opioid receptors. Short-acting opioids are those opioids that take effect almost immediatelybut for which the effects are more short-lived. An individual will feel the effects of one of these opioids for no more than four to six hours and oftentimes less.
